A mixture of
1/3 compost
1/3 peat moss
1/3 coarse vermiculite
That's all there is to it. No dirt is needed!
It's actually no secret at all but is Mel's Recipe from his Square Foot Gardening website. It really is the best!
"A blended compost made from many ingredients provides all the nutrients the plants require (no chemical fertilizers needed). Peat moss and vermiculite help hold moisture and keep the soil loose. It's best to make your own compost from many ingredients.
When buying vermiculite, be sure to get the coarse grade, and get the more economical 4 cubic foot size bags. If placing frames over grass you can dig out the grass or cover it with cardboard or landscape cloth to discourage grass and weeds from coming up through your new garden soil."
